One person killed as car crashes

One person has died and another was taken to hospital with serious injuries after a crash in Bedfordshire.

A car left the A421 road and burst into flames at Lidlington Turn near junction 13 of the M1, in the early hours.

One person died at the scene, a second was taken to hospital and a third ran away, a police spokesman said.

"A patrol was monitoring the car before the crash and the Independent Police Complaints Commission has been informed in line with protocol," he said.

The A421 road is closed between Marston Moretaine and the M1 and traffic is being diverted onto other routes.

Police said the road could be closed until late morning.
